The Gym Group is looking for a Fitness Manager based in Manchester Fallowfield. This full-time role involves managing a team of fitness trainers and ensuring high member satisfaction. You should be passionate about fitness and possess strong leadership skills.
The company is known for its fun, inclusive culture and is committed to supporting personal and professional development. Apply today and become an integral part of our team!
